Cosmos atrosanguineus
Chocolate Cosmos brings a piece of exotic Mexico to gardens. This unusual species attracts from afar with its typical scent reminiscent of dark chocolate, and the 'Eclipse' cultivar adds stunning velvety flowers in a dark burgundy color. You will receive a rooted seedling from us, which you can easily transplant according to your needs. Given its origin, it loves full sun and well-drained, slightly moist soil. It grows as a short-lived perennial, and because it only tolerates frost down to about minus twelve degrees, it is most often grown as a portable container plant. It looks great in a large pot on a balcony or terrace, but you can also hide it with the container in a flower bed among ornamental grasses, where it will bloom continuously from July to October. With the arrival of winter, you simply take it out and store it in a frost-free room. It reliably attracts many bees and other beneficial pollinators. Furthermore, the dark red flower heads are perfect for cutting. In a vase, they create an impressive contrast to more delicate light flowers and stay fresh for many days. The cosmos doesn't need any complex pest or disease care, so even someone who is just starting with similar portable species will quickly make friends with it.
